The textual ideas were developed in collaboration with Rosalind McGrath for songs One and Two, whereas Three is an adaptation of lines from 'The Opal', a poem written by William Porter-Young. The fourth song is a collage of mnemonic sounds ... and Indian pitch sounds.

This is the 4th movt of the work Songs for Imberombera.

The song text is not indigenous, but rather a collage including the following: classical Indian pitch names sa, re, ni; Brazilian conga drum pattern names, goo, ba, kin. West African percussion mnemonics dzi dza; and di-te-re-mo, vocables sung into a didjeridu for articulation purposes.
